Job Title: X-Ray Technologist

Reports to: Clinic Manager

Shift Details: Fulltime, M-F, 8:30am-5:00pm

Key Responsibilities:

  • Perform X-ray examinations on patients according to physician orders and established protocols.
  • Adjust X-ray equipment settings to obtain high-quality diagnostic images.
  • Ensure the comfort and safety of patients during imaging procedures, providing clear instructions and answering any questions.
  • Position patients correctly for optimal imaging results.
  • Evaluate the quality of X-ray images to ensure diagnostic accuracy.
  • Make adjustments to equipment as needed to optimize image quality.
  • Record and maintain accurate patient information, including medical history and X-ray details, in electronic health records (EHR).
  • Prepare and deliver comprehensive reports of completed X-ray examinations to the referring physicians.
  • Perform routine maintenance on X-ray equipment and coordinate with the appropriate personnel for repairs.
  • Ensure compliance with safety protocols and radiation protection standards.
  • Collaborate with radiologists, physicians, and other healthcare professionals to discuss imaging results and determine the appropriate course of action.
  • Communicate effectively with patients and healthcare staff to coordinate appointments and address inquiries.
  • Adhere to regulatory and safety guidelines, including HIPAA, and maintain compliance with all applicable standards and regulations.
  • Participate in quality assurance activities to ensure ongoing adherence to imaging protocols.
  • Stay informed about advancements in X-ray technology, attend relevant training, and participate in continuing education to enhance technical skills and knowledge.
  • Knowledge and compliance with safety measures to minimize exposure to ionizing radiation.
  • Adherence to infection control protocols, including the use of personal protective equipment (PPE) when necessary.
  • Other duties as assigned

Qualifications:

  • ARRT Certification required
  • ACLS Certification is required and provided by company
  • BLS Certification is required
  • Enthusiastic outlook and can-do attitude
  • Strong technical skills in operating X-ray equipment and ensuring image quality
  • Team focused
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
